Those wings on the H2R? I can absolutely tell you they work. After 100 mph you can feel the difference. The H2 floats its front wheel, even if fourth gear. The front wheel is light. In fourth gear on the H2R, the front wheel was heavy. It felt firmly planted on the ground, which told me the wings worked. The bike was super steady at high speed.

For that test, I brought along my 2015 ZX-14R, set up the same exact way, with stock wheelbase and lowered, that’s it. Everything else was factory. Did the same thing to the H2. The ZX-14R ran a 9.16 at 149 mph. The H2, with H2R pipes and ECU tuning very similar to the H2R’s, went 9.16 at 160. That’s 11 mph better!

The H2 Hybrid has a 68-inch wheelbase, as opposed to 56.5 stock. The swingarm is 11 inches longer than stock. Right now, it also has a BST carbon rear wheel. We’re gonna put one on the front as well.

It makes 292 horsepower to the rear wheel on pump gas. KHI is very smart. They are never going to run anything on the edge. When we checked the air-fuel ratio, it was 11.3 to 11.4. That’s how rich they had it. They had to make sure it’s safe enough for anybody who gets their hands on it to not blow it up. We knew from racing my turbo bike that we can lean it out quite a bit more than that. So we took the air-fuel ratio to about 12.2 and picked up 30 horsepower. With the leaner mixture and improved airflow, we went from 269 horsepower to 292. If you equate that to crankshaft horsepower, that would be around 320 horsepower.

It has a hard rev limiter. The tach gets red at 14,000 rpm, but the redline area is from 14,000 to 16,000 rpm. But it hits the rev limiter right at 14,100. Turbochargers typically sign off at a certain rpm. A supercharger continues to make boost as long as you continue to rev the engine. I believe my motorcycle could go another 2 or 3 mph faster if I could rev it a little more.

People keep commenting about how heavy the H2 is. They’re appalled that it’s listed as 530 lb. I will say this: I never believed the bike was that heavy, so I pulled it onto a scale. In completely stock trim (no carbon, except where the mirrors and wings are), my bike weighed 475 lb. stock, with a gallon of gas. Then, at our December test with the extended swingarm and carbon rear wheel, the bike weighed only 460 lb. I weighed my ZX-14R school bike that same day, set up the same way and with a gallon of fuel. It weighed 530 lb. Sure, if you compare the H2 to a liter bike, it’s heavy. But it also has a steel frame, a supercharger, and what looks like the heaviest exhaust I’ve ever seen on a production bike.

This one-of-a-kind Ninja H2™ hybrid was customized for ultimate drag-strip performance by 11-time Kawasaki Drag Racing champion Rickey Gadson, in conjunction with Kawasaki Heavy Industries, Ltd. and Adams Performance. It was designed specifically for Rickey Gadson to meet certain drag racing specifications.
